Are you looking to advance your career and flex your Leadership and Program Finance skills in a fast-paced and rewarding organization?

Join us! As Program Finance Manager II, you will be responsible for leading the Program Finance team in implementation and management of the integrated program management process in line with industry best practices, program standards, corporate governance, and associated contract requirements.

Focused responsibilities include development and management of integrated program management practice standards, independent program assessments, peer reviews to ensure proper application of integrated program management guidelines, and development of program finance team members.

You will also support the Program Finance leaders in fulfilling their responsibilities to ongoing cross department continuous improvement, problem solving, project implementation, training, and governance efforts.

Responsibilities :

  • Ownership of the Program Finance software tool sets to include Cobra, MSP, PM Compass and reporting avenues such as Power BI dashboards, Costpoint Business Intelligence, etc.
  • Primary data steward of Program Finance tool data.
  • Lead optimization and continuous improvement efforts related to the tool environments with the goal of scalability
  • Own training documents and training program implementation.
  • Provide user support for tools around best practices
  • Own instructional documents related to tools
  • Act as SME for any decisions related to tools, processes, and procedures.

Must Haves :

  • Bachelor's degree in a Business related field of study
  • Relevant experience may be considered in lieu of required education
  • Proven leadership abilities inclusive of successful change management, mentoring, career development, and training
  • Experience in scheduling software (MS Project), Earned Value Management software (Deltek Cobra), and self service analytics (PowerBI)
  • A strong background in Program Controls fundamentals inclusive of program risk management
  • Must have business management experience related to program execution.
  • Must have user experience in Cobra, MSP, and / or other program management related toolsets.

Preferred :

  • Certification in PMP, EVP, & PMI-SP desirable
  • Adept at communicating with program personnel, senior management and customer representatives
  • Experience developing complex solutions in a collaborative, cross-functional environment
  • Support the needs of employees through career development, mentorship, and training
  • Knowledge of DoD, government contracting and / or public auditing, policies, standards, and procedures
  • Experience in successful completion of Program IBRs, JSRs and Internal Surveillances (to include completion of actions items)
  • Ability to cultivate and foster an active network across regulatory groups, sponsors / customers, and other key stakeholders
